The South Point Park Tour in Miami Beach offers visitors a chance to explore the city’s southernmost park and its picturesque waterfront setting.

Priced from $40 per person, this guided tour accommodates up to 15 travelers and provides snacks and water.

The meeting point is the Apogee Condominium, with the tour returning to the same location.

The experience is accessible, with wheelchair and stroller access, as well as allowing service animals. Infants must sit on laps.

Most travelers can participate, and free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the tour starts.

Meeting and Pickup

Travelers meet at the Apogee Condominium, located at 800 South Pointe Dr, Miami Beach, FL 33139, USA.

This is the designated starting point for the South Point Park tour. The tour ends at the same location, allowing participants to easily find their way back.

The meeting point is wheelchair accessible and near public transportation, making it convenient for a variety of travelers.
